The Russians Targeted Prokrovsk
Prokrovsk is about 30, 40 miles from the line of contact. It's always been considered slightly safer than Kramatorsk. A hotel called Druszbert was very popular with journalists and volunteers. Witnesses said there was no air raid warning before it happened. The first missile hit the building that was housing the pizza restaurant. The second one hit the hotel. Another one of the casualties was a police officer by the name of Vladimir Nakulin.
